R. Kelly’s Lawyers File Motion to Transfer Singer Out of Solitary Confinement

r. kelly

*We previously reported… R. Kelly’s lawyer says the singer is miserable while being held in solitary confinement, so an emergency motion was filed on Thursday arguing he should be transferred out while awaiting trial on child pornography charges.

Kelly faces various sex crime charges in multiple states and jurisdictions and is currently being held at the federal Metropolitan Correctional Center in downtown Chicago.

Steve Greenberg, who is leading Kelly’s courtroom battle in Chicago on child pornography and sex abuse charges, claims his client “has a stage persona who is used to having people around him all the time. His life in solitary is now minus TV. No radio. No music. And no books,” the Sun-Times reports. 

Kelly is getting no “meaningful interaction with other humans,” and his legal team believes he’s being unfairly targeted because of his alleged crimes and celebrity status, per Page Six.

Kelly was arrested by federal authorities on child porn and sex abuse charges in July. The Bureau of Prisons determined he could not be held in general population for his own safety, according to the motion.

The hitmaker has requested a transfer out of solitary confinement to general population, but BOP has reportedly made clear that he’s not be eligible for a transfer “because of his alleged offense and notoriety,” according to the motion.

Lawyers say BOP is housing Kelly on “the most restrictive floor,” instead of moving him to any number of less restrictive floors away from gen pop. 

“In essence, even though he has not violated a single BOP rule, Mr. Kelly is being unconstitutionally punished and segregated from the rest of the prison population,” they wrote in the motion.

R. Kelly is also being denied access to recreation and time in the sun/fresh air, the motion states.
